Identify a person who you consider to be a successful and effective leader. This could be someone you work with or for (for example: business, professional, sport, volunteer work, religious organisations etc) or anyone who through some association you judge to be a good leader.
Describe in detail what you observe this person doing in their leadership role and what you perceive this person's leadership styles, behaviours, traits and his/her use of power and influence tactics that make him/her an effective leader. You must be able to apply the theories in the course and text to support your observation.
